Checks and Balances in the Constitution
One of the most unique and important elements of our Constitution is its system of simple, yet powerful, checks and balances. The Constitution balances the strengths of each branch and the states to allow government the necessary power to fulfill its proper role while at the same time checking the power of any one level or branch of government from usurping the Constitutionally defined role of the others.
